So....What is a Play Day then?

A ‘Play day’ is a club event organized on private land which the club hires for the purpose.  The club caters for all levels of driver ability at these events, from absolute beginners who have never been off road before, through to very experienced drivers.  We also cater for all types of Land Rover vehicles, from Series vehicles through to purpose built hybrids, even Freelanders and latest versions of the Range Rover have been know to come along!

Please note There are a couple of sites that we use which can be extreme (such as Minstead) which means they are not well suited for shiny and expensive vehicles.  This will normally be noted in the event description.  Please check with the event organizer or a committee member if you have not used a site before and are concerned about vehicle damage

Most events will have a burger van or similar on site to provide drinks and something to eat.  If it is not possible for the club to arrange this then there will be a note in the event listing. 

The events are marshaled by experienced volunteers whose prime role is to ensure safety on site; they will also lend advice and assistance as required.  The marshals police the event to ensure the clubs Code of Conduct is adhered to.  Failure to comply with the Code of Conduct or marshal’s instructions will mean that you will be asked to leave the site.

As with all club events your vehicle needs to have adequate insurance cover and a valid MOT certificate to participate.  If you are bringing your vehicle on a trailer or lorry to an event don’t forget your documents! 

At the event there will be a sign in point where you will need to sign in with a valid membership card.  You will receive a window sticker to say you have done this, any instructions or extra safety considerations for the day and usually a site map.  Please do not venture out of the car park onto the site before you have done this or you will be asked to leave.

At the end of the day please ensure you sign out so we know everyone has left the site before the marshals leave.

On some sites we are limited to the total number of vehicles on site, and others have historically been poorly attended.  It is therefore very important to pre-book if you are interested in attending events.  Failure to do so will mean that you will not be able to attend events where numbers are limited if they become fully booked.  Events at sites which have been poorly attended in the past will be cancelled if the number of pre-booked vehicles does not cover the cost of the site to the club.
